Transaction 333f356276877286447e241fe634537001546031a00fd08435bccec75b8356a0
1 Input
1 Output
-
333f356276877286447e241fe634537001546031a00fd08435bccec75b8356a0:0
- value
- 7598155
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daafefa02fe5bfff9d2dc8d82225acc5d521b17
- address
- bc1qhk40a7szledll7wjmjxcygj6e3w4yxch7gr69l